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

target exists

has an ancestor

ManageDsaIT present

JNDI/protocol handling

Description

yes no

no

yes no

JNDI

Add Adds the entry. If it's a referral, no specific treatment.updates the ReferralManager

no

no
yes

no

yes

protocol

Add Adds the entry. If it's a referral, no specific treatment. updates the ReferralManager

no yes

no no

yes

JNDI

Add Adds the entry. If it's a referral, no specific treatment.

yes

updates the ReferralManager

no

no no

yes

protocol

Add Adds the entry, no specific treatment.

no

yes

yes

JNDI

Return an UnwillingToPerform error

. If it's a referral, updatse the ReferralManager

no

yes

yes

protocol

Return an UnwillingToPerform error

no yes

no

JNDI

Return Returns a Referral LdapResult, with the ancestor's URLs

no

yes

no

protocol

Return Returns a Referral LdapResult, with the ancestor's URLs

no no

yes

yes

JNDI Add the entry. If it's a referral, update the ReferralManager

Returns an UnwillingToPerform error

no no

yes

yes

protocol

Returns an UnwillingToPerform error

yes

no

no

JNDI

Adds the entry, no specific treatment.

yes Add the entry. If it's a referral, update the ReferralManager

no

no

protocol

Adds the entry, no specific treatment.

yes

no

yes

JNDI

Add Adds the entry. If it's a referral, update the ReferralManager , no specific treatment.

yes no

no no

yes

protocol

Add Adds the entry. If it's a referral, update the ReferralManager , no specific treatment.

Compare Operation handling

target exists

has an ancestor case

ManageDsaIT present

JNDI/protocol handling

Description

no

no

no

case 1

yes

JNDI

 

Returns a NoSuchObject result

no

no

no

 

 

protocol

 

Returns a NoSuchObject result

no  

no

yes

JNDI

Returns a NoSuchObject result

  no  

no

  yes

protocol

 

Returns a NoSuchObject result

no case 2

yes

no

JNDI

 

 

 

protocol

 

 

no

JNDI

 

 

 

protocol

 

case 3

yes

JNDI

 

 

 

protocol

 

 

no

JNDI

 

 

 

protocol

 

case 4

yes

JNDI

 

 

 

protocol

 

 

no

JNDI

 

Returns a Referral LdapResult, with the ancestor's URLs

no

yes

no

protocol

Returns a Referral LdapResult, with the ancestor's URLs

no

yes

yes

JNDI

Returns an UnwillingToPerform error

no

yes

yes

protocol

Returns an UnwillingToPerform error

yes

no

no

JNDI

Compares the object and returns the result

yes

no

no

protocol

Compares the object and returns the result

yes

no

yes

JNDI

Compares the object and returns the result

yes

no

yes

protocol

Compares the object and returns the result

 

 

protocol

 

Delete Operation handling

...